In Australia, a full time Full Stack Developer generally earns $2,350 per week ($122,200 annual salary) before tax. This is a median figure for full-time employees and should be considered a guide only. As you gain more experience you can expect a potentially higher salary than people who are new to the industry.

This industry has seen strong employment growth in recent years. There are currently 8,600 people working in this field in Australia and many of them specialise as a Full Stack Developer. Full Stack Developers may find work across all regions of Australia, particularly larger towns and cities.

Source: Australian Government Labour Market Insights

If you’re interested in a career as a Full Stack Developer, consider enrolling in an Advanced Diploma of Information Technology (Full Stack Web Development). This course covers a range of topics including designing user experience solutions, building advanced user interfaces, creating and developing REST APIs and implementing cybersecurity best practices.

For those who are new to the field, there are fantastic beginner options available. The Certificate III in Information Technology (Web Development) ICT30120 offers a solid foundation in web development, guiding you through the essential tools and technologies. Additionally, programmes like Software Engineering: Transform and Front-End Web Development: Transform provide hands-on experience that is crucial for launching your career as a Full Stack Developer.

If you already possess some qualifications or experience, you might be interested in the more advanced offerings. The Certificate IV in Information Technology (Web Development) ICT40120 will deepen your knowledge and expertise, preparing you for higher-level responsibilities in the tech space. For those aiming even higher, the Bachelor of Computer Science (Software Engineering) provides an extensive understanding of software development and design principles, equipping you for a thriving career in software engineering.
